Block

#18,921,053
Block Number
18,921,053 @ 06/24/2024, 15:14:20
Status
Finalized
ID
0x0120b65d438f556ab2a4e715976af6b38319b5df34d4512a0c3ec0d64ccbbee6
Transactions
Gas Used
105164/40000000 (0.26% Used)
Total Score
159,445,385 (+14)
Rewards
0.63 VTHO